IN THE HIGH COURT OF PUNJAB & HARYANA AT CHANDIGARH 217 CRM-M-26434-2026(O&M) Date of decision: 14.05.2026 Sagar @ Gandhi ...Petitioner VERSUS State of Haryana ...Respondent CORAM : HON'BLE MR. JUSTICE VINOD S. BHARDWAJ Present :- Ms. Anita Sharma, Advocate for the petitioner. Mr. Paras Talwar, Sr. DAG, Haryana. ***** VINOD S. BHARDWAJ, J. (Oral) The instant petition has been filed under Section 483 of the Bharatiya Nagarik Suraksha Sanhita, 2023 for grant of regular bail to the petitioner in case bearing FIR No.252 dated 11.11.2024 registered under Sections 103(2), 190, 191(3) and 61 of the Bharatiya Nyaya Sanhita, 2023 at Police Station Sadar Ambala, District Ambala. 2. The aforesaid FIR was registered on the statement of Mohit Kumar Yadav son of Sh. Devi Parshad. The translated version thereof reads thus:- “My younger brother, Vishal alias Vishu, age 21, worked at a bangle shop in the cloth market on Shukla Kund Road, Ambala city. Yesterday on 10.11.2024 at about 9.00 A.M. deceased Vishal @Vishu had gone to his job and about 10.45 P.M.
